III. Windows 98 Operating System Requirements NOTE: The AGP-V3500 series graphics cards require a motherboard with an AGP slot. It is strongly recommended that you use Windows98 with these graphics cards. The AGP-V3500 series graphics cards are fully compatible and works best with Windows98. Windows 98 Windows 98 supports full Direct3D and AGP features.
III. Windows 98 Driver Setup You can use one of three methods to install the Windows 98 drivers for your ASUS AGP-V3500 series graphics card. NOTE: Method 2 and Method 3 will not install the appropriate AGP GART driver if your motherboard does not use the Intel AGPset. Installing the AGP GART driver will ensure that the AGPset’s AGP functions are available. Method 2 and Method 3 will not install also the DirectX runtime libraries.

III. Windows 98 Install GART Driver The AGP GART Driver is used to support AGP functionality for the chipset on your PC’s motherboard. It is recommended to install the GART driver if it is newer than the one you have installed in your system. NOTE: Installation dialogs are slightly different for each chipset. Follow the onscreen instructions to finish the VGARTD installation. The succeeding steps assume that you are installing for an Intel AGPset. III. Windows 98 Install GART 1.
